Chapter 209: Crimson Iron City [1]
BOOMβ!
A sudden, violent explosion shattered the damp silence of the Mist Cloud Forest, sending a shower of pulverized stone, dirt, and ancient moss raining down into the dense foliage.
As the thick plumes of dust slowly settled, a jagged fissure in the side of a hidden cliffside collapsed completely, revealing the gaping mouth of a newly formed cave.
From the shadows of the subterranean passage, a figure stepped smoothly out into the dim forest light.
The man stood at a height of five feet nine inches, possessing a strikingly slender frame and a complexion of smooth, almost unnatural pale skin.
His long, vibrant green hair fell loosely over his shoulders, catching the filtered sunlight.
Yet, despite his slender appearance, the raw, suffocating pressure he radiated was absolutely massive.
The air around him rippled and warped with every breath he took, projecting the terrifying, unyielding aura of a high-and-mighty Nascent Soul cultivator.
This was the identity Shen Yu had chosen to spearhead his conquest of Crimson Iron City. The name of this new identity was Mo Liu.
To ensure this disguise was completely foolproof against even the most discerning eyes of the cultivation world, Shen Yu had methodically stacked multiple high-level concealment techniques.
First, he had activated the Blood Burning Art, forcefully shifting his underlying bone structure and physical proportions from his native, towering build to this slender, green-haired form.
Next, he channeled his inner core to trigger his bloodline's intrinsic ability, the Crimson Fox Veil, seamlessly altering his unique Qi signature and his deep voice into an entirely different frequency.
Finally, he tapped into the mystical bracelet resting securely around his wrist.
Because he had already broken through to the genuine Foundation Establishment realm, he was able to project a flawlessly simulated, terrifying Nascent Soul aura to intimidate any potential obstacles.
A cold, amused smile touched Shen Yu's lips as he felt the sheer weight of his disguise.
Without a single moment of hesitation, his body blurred into a streak of green light, leaping through the canopy as he began to run at breakneck speed toward the opposite end of the vast, fog-laden Mist Cloud Forest.
Two days passed in a blur of continuous, rapid travel.
On the morning of the third day, Shen Yu stood silently on the precipice of a jagged mountain cliff.
His piercing gaze locked onto the foot of a massive, neighboring mountain range that dominated the horizon.
Unlike the lush greenery of his journey, these peaks were a striking, metallic reddish color, surrounded by matching crimson-hued flora that grew from the mineral-rich soil.
Nestled tightly within the valley at the foot of these iron mountains was a sprawling, heavily fortified metropolis.

Crimson Iron City.
This legendary settlement was widely renowned across the realm as a powerhouse of metallurgy and craftsmanship.
Built directly over volcanic veins and rich geological deposits, Crimson Iron City was world-famous for its high-grade spiritual ores and the exceptionally durable weapons and armor forged within its subterranean foundries.
The city operated primarily as a massive export hub; nearly seventy percent of the raw materials and finished martial artifacts produced here were loaded onto heavily armed merchant caravans, destined for distant empires and wealthy cultivation clans.
Yet, beneath this facade of industrial wealth lay a critical, glaring vulnerability: the local medical market.
Because the excavation of crimson-iron ore released highly toxic, metal-infused dust into the deeper mines, the demand for healing panaceas and cleansing elixirs was astronomically high.
Consequently, the pill market here was vast, dwarfing that of non-industrial territories.
Because the city's soil was too metallic to naturally cultivate delicate medicinal flora, herbs had to be imported at exorbitant costs, making refined pills significantly more expensive here than in coastal metropolises like Thousand Waves City.
A common medicinal pill that would cost a few low-grade spiritual stones elsewhere was treated like a luxury here, drained greedily by miners and mercenaries just to keep their meridians from corroding.
His green eyes flared with a predatory hunger. Stepping off the cliffside, he descended the mountain path and began a steady, deliberate walk toward the primary northern entrance of the city.
Before the stern, armored guards could even blink or raise their halberds to demand entry taxes, Shen Yu subtly triggered a specialized cultivation technique: the Phantom Void Mirage Step.
This was a high-grade movement and concealment art that had originally caught his eye during the very first week of the system's Primal Store rotation.
Lacking the necessary funds at the time, he had proactively saved the technique in his digital cart, waiting for the right moment to strike.
Because the subsequent weeks of the store rotation had featured lackluster, underwhelming items, he had held onto his resources without a single shred of hesitation. The moment his Desire Points reached the mark, he had immediately finalized the purchase.
The technique was an absolute masterpiece for stealth operations.
Unlike basic illusion arts that merely bent light, the Phantom Void Mirage Step allowed the user to subtly blend their presence into the ambient spiritual frequencies of the environment.
It manipulated the sensory perception of anyone looking directly at him, causing their minds to automatically register his physical form as nothing more than a passing breeze or an irrelevant trick of the light.
As he stepped forward, the space around his slender, green-haired form rippled with a faint, undetectable distortion.
To the guards and the surrounding crowd, it was as if a minor shadow had briefly brushed against their senses.
He walked smoothly past the threshold, crossing straight into the bustling, iron-scented streets of the city without a single inspection guard even registering that a living soul had just bypassed their line.
